Explore the enchanting beauty of Deutsch Evern with the Deutsch Evern Trail. This 53 km gravel route offers varying terrains and breathtaking scenery, suitable for very well-trained amateurs seeking a challenge. Admire the panoramic views from Timeloberg and immerse yourself in the tranquility of Deutsch Evern. Pass through picturesque Embsen and Luhmühlen, famous for its equestrian events. Discover the historic landmarks of Dönnsenberg and Lüneburg, each offering a unique glimpse into the region's past. The Klostergut Willerding adds an extra touch of charm to this unforgettable adventure.
